The production is also notable for being part of a planned new trilogy. Boyle and Garland have reportedly shot 28 Years Later back-to-back with its sequel, 28 Years Later: Part II – The Bone Temple , directed by Nia DaCosta ( Candyman ). This indicates a long-term commitment to expanding the universe, regardless of the mixed reception to this first chapter.

But peace is a fragile concept in Boyle’s universe. The narrative is driven by a single individual who, for reasons the plot keeps close to its chest, is forced to leave the island's safety and venture back into the overgrown, silent ruins of the mainland. What they discover is far worse than the initial apocalypse. The Rage Virus has not remained static; it has undergone a "unexpected transformation." The infected, once mindless vectors of fury, have evolved or mutated in chilling ways. However, the film’s central thesis, as revealed in the synopsis, is that the most horrifying monster is not the virus itself, but the "darkest aspects of the human soul."
